Spacious Traditional House with Extensive Land in Tamba City
The main building is a wooden structure with a tiled roof, featuring a total floor area of 419.6 square meters (126.92 tsubo). The layout includes a 4DK or larger floor plan. The property comprises three separate structures: two residential buildings and a warehouse. The first residential building has an area of 135.87 square meters on the first floor and 75.13 square meters on the second floor, with an additional 39.16 square meters of annex space, though its construction year is unknown. The second residential building was built in 1974 (Showa 49) and measures 127.05 square meters. The warehouse consists of two sections totaling 42.39 square meters, also of unknown age. It is important to note that the property is sold in its current condition, meaning there are areas requiring repair and equipment work.
Agent notes highlight the property's key features: a spacious feeling due to its elevated location and the extensive land area. The plot includes 1,036.63 square meters of residential land and 1,550 square meters of miscellaneous use land. Utilities include Kansai Electric Power, propane gas, and public water supply. The property has parking available and fronts a 4-meter wide paved road. The building coverage ratio is 60% with a floor area ratio of 200%, and the area is not subject to specific urban planning or zoning regulations.
